Nominations now being accepted for WIA Demeter Award of Excellence

TOPSFIELD, Mass., March 5, 2024 – Nomination submissions are now being accepted for the 2024 Women in Agribusiness (WIA) Demeter Award of Excellence. Deadline for submission is Friday, June 14.

For more than a decade, the WIA Demeter Award of Excellence has been highlighting women who have excelled in the sector, exhibiting superior performance in their field and/or demonstrating an outstanding contribution to agribusiness. Up to three recipients are selected each year and invited to attend – with complimentary registration – the annual Women in Agribusiness Summit, which will take place this year in Denver, Colorado, September 24-26. There, Demeter Award recipients will be recognized on-stage and presented with the award.

 

Past recipients have been chosen for accomplishments such as: establishing a woman’s network with the goal of advancing women (Meshea Brodie, manager at Bayer CropScience – 2013); transforming the largest farmer co-operative in the UK from operating at a huge loss to ending with an $8 million profit, and a $30 million increase in revenue (Christine Tacon, groceries code adjudicator, UK Regulator – 2018); and, launching accelerators to commercialize early-stage ag technologies and supporting women in their entrepreneurial pursuits (Karen LeVert, venture partner, Pappas Capital – 2022). Criteria to consider when submitting a nomination are:

 

  • A minimum of 10 years of experience in the agriculture and/or food industry.

  • Notable professional achievements. 

  • An inspiring role model for other women in the industry.

  • Actively dismantles barriers, fosters opportunities, and acts as a valuable resource for others.

  • Consistently exemplifies professionalism.

 

Note that there is no limit to the number of entries, and self-nominations are permissible. Use this form for submissions.

About Women in Agribusiness

 

Women in Agribusiness (WIA) seeks to grow a professional community of women in agribusiness as they learn from one another, develop their careers and build beneficial relationships in the sector. WIA took root in 2012, and now includes WIA Membership, WIA Demeter Award of Excellence, Student Scholarships, WIA Career Connector, and the WIA Today blog. Learn more at womeninag.com.
